  • What other sports teams play in Boston?

    Boston is a great sports town, full of history and championship teams. The very same arena (TD Gardens) also hosts the NBA’s Boston Celtics, and Boston is also home to the famous (or infamous) Boston Red Sox of Major League Baseball as well as the MLS team the New England Revolution. Boston is also home to the New England Patriots, and although Boston residents can’t claim to be the only fans of that very popular team, the Patriots do play at Gillette Stadium in nearby Foxborough. If you happen to be in town for a Bruins game, make sure to check out the options in the other leagues while you’re there. This could be the perfect time to make this weekend a multi-sport extravaganza. Fenway Park anyone?

  • Where do the Boston Bruins play their games?

    The Big Bad Bruins play their games at TD Garden, which is also the home of the Boston Celtics. TD Garden was built in 1995, and is the most popular sports and entertainment arena in all of New England, with over three million people visiting each year. Conveniently located directly above North Station, which is a commuter and intercity rail terminal in Boston, fans can arrive by car or public transportation. The capacity of TD Gardens is 17,565, although it can be expanded to more accommodate 20,000 for concerts.

  • Who are the biggest rivals to the Boston Bruins?

    While opinions may vary, there is a strong case to be made that the Montreal Canadiens are the biggest rivals of the Boston Bruins. With over 700 total regular season games played between the two franchises since the NHL was formed (as well as 34 playoff series’), both teams and their respective fanbases truly despise one another. That said, Boston often has a heated rivalry with the Philadelphia Flyers and the Vancouver Canucks as well.

  • Are Boston Bruins tickets expensive?

    According to numbers based on the 2019-2020 season, prices for a Boston Bruins game will set you back an average of $115, which is approximately the 10th-most expensive place to watch a game out of the NHL’s 31 markets. However, on the secondary ticket market (re-sold and scalped tickets), Boston ranks up nearer to the top of the list, where a fan can expect to pay up to $215 to see a game.
